SCAD seeks a full-time professor of business of beauty and fragrance for its location in historic Savannah, Ga.
In this position, your primary responsibility will be to help prepare students for cross-functional careers in business, beauty, fragrance, fashion, and marketing.
The successful candidate has a strong background in the fragrance and/or beauty industry and can use this knowledge to motivate students and faculty from diverse backgrounds to think creatively and critically.
Requirements
- Terminal degree or equivalent in beauty, fragrance, or a related discipline
- Professional expertise in beauty, fragrance, branding, digital marketing, entrepreneurship, e-commerce, and social media
- Collegiate-level teaching experience preferred
- Ability to be credentialed through SACS guidelines or justified to teach
